1. Comprehending Cat Doors
Cat doors can be found in numerous designs, varying from basic flap doors to electronic models that just enable signed up family pets to pass through. Repair My Windows And Doors of cat door chosen considerably impacts both the overall cost and installation problem.
Kinds Of Cat Doors:
| Type | Description | Average Cost (GBP) |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Flap Door | Fundamental installation, frequently made from plastic or wood. |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 |
| Magnetic Flap Door | Functions magnets to keep the flap close. | ₤ 25 - ₤ 75 |
| Electronic Cat Door | Uses a microchip or a key fob to allow access. | ₤ 150 - ₤ 500 |
| Wall-Mounted Door | Installed through a wall rather than a door. |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 |
2. Factors Influencing Installation Costs
Numerous aspects add to the installation prices of cat doors, including:
-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ors, like electronic models, typically require more detailed installation.
- Installation Site: Installing a door on a solid wood door normally costs less than installing one on a wall.
- Home Design: Older or uniquely designed homes may present extra challenges for installation, resulting in increased costs.
- Labor Costs: Geographic location and demand in your area will affect the hourly rates of installers.
- Additional Features: Features such as security locks or weather sealing will contribute to the overall cost.
3. Typical Costs of Cat Door Installation
The table below illustrates the typical expenses associated with hiring a professional to install a cat door.
| Service Included | Typical Cost (GBP) |
|---|---|
| Basic Installation (Flap Door) | ₤ 100 - ₤ 200 |
| Complex Installation (Wall, Electronic) | ₤ 200 - ₤ 500 |
| Extra Custom Features | ₤ 25 - ₤ 50 per function |
| Removal of Existing Door |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
| Cost of Materials | ₤ 20 - ₤ 100 |
4. The Price Breakdown of Cat Door Installation
An in-depth price breakdown can help prospective pet owners comprehend what to expect regarding cat door installation costs.
- Preliminary Consultation: An assessment charge often ranges from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, depending on whether you need the service to encourage on door choice or installation strategy.
- Products: The average cost of materials can differ, specifically if you have specific options (like vinyl, wood, or custom-made functions). Anticipate to pay in between ₤ 20 and ₤ 100 for materials.
- Labor Costs: The per hour labor rate for professionals can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 80, depending on the intricacy of the installation and your geographical area.
- Various Add-Ons: If you need additional functions, such as weather removing or customized framing, the expenses can add ₤ 25 to ₤ 50 per improvement.
5. Advantages and disadvantages of Professional Installation
When choosing whether to hire a professional for cat door installation, it is vital to weigh the benefits and drawbacks.
Pros:
- Expertise: Professionals have the understanding and experience to manage varying degrees of difficulty.
- Time-Saving: Hiring a professional saves you time and potential trouble related to a DIY project.
- Guarantees: Professional setups often feature warranties on both work and materials.
- Quality Assurance: Proper installation can ensure much better functionality and sturdiness of the cat door.
Cons:
- Cost: The most considerable downside is naturally the included expenditure compared to a DIY job.
- Scheduling: You may need to await a professional's accessibility, delaying the installation.
- Loss of Control: You may have less control over the materials and design aspects compared to doing it yourself.
6. FAQs
Q1: Can I set up a cat door myself to save money?A1: Yes, numerous pet owners choose to set up cat doors as a DIY task. However, remember that this needs some general handyman abilities, and inappropriate installation might result in problems down the roadway. Q2: Are there any specific permits required for installing a cat door?A2: Generally, a lot of homes do not require licenses for cat door installation, however it's important to check local building guidelines, especially for wall setups. Q3: How do I select the ideal size for my cat door?A3: Measure your cat's height and width to ensure that the door you select will accommodate their size conveniently, usually permitting a couple of extra inches for ease of access.
